ZIP 33635 and ZIP 33637 are ZIP Code areas in Florida.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 33635 has the higher population (19,415 vs 17,785 in ZIP 33637). ZIP 33635 has the higher median household income ($83,843 vs $60,526 in ZIP 33637). ZIP 33635 has the higher median home value ($309,800 vs $213,800 in ZIP 33637).
